Snellville Crime Rate Report (Georgia)

Snellville crime statistics report an overall downward trend in crime based on data from 26 years with violent crime increasing and property crime decreasing. Based on this trend, the crime rate in Snellville for 2026 is expected to be lower than in 2025.

The city violent crime rate for Snellville in 2025 was lower than the national violent crime rate average by 47.79% and the city property crime rate in Snellville was higher than the national property crime rate average by 6.88%.

In 2025 the city violent crime rate in Snellville was lower than the violent crime rate in Georgia by 42.38% and the city property crime rate in Snellville was higher than the property crime rate in Georgia by 16.4%.

* The source of actual data on this Snellville, Georgia crime rate report is the FBI Report of Offenses Known to Law Enforcement for the corresponding year or years. Arson numbers are reported inconsistently. Zero values may indicate the data was not available. The projected crime rate data displayed above was generated from the trends found in the years of actual reported crime data on file. In this case, the Snellville crime report data for 2026 was projected from 26 years of actual data. The last year of actual available crime data, as reported above, was 2025.

The FBI cautions the data users against comparing yearly statistical data solely on the basis of their population coverage. The comparisons made herein are thus, only meaningful upon further examination of all variables that affect crime in each reported city, state or other reported jurisdicition.
